One of the most important things to consider when planning an event is the decoration. And when you say event decorations, you will need to shop for balloons, lanterns, cloths and, most especially, flowers. Of course, hiring a professional florist is a must. However, you need to learn how to pick the ideal designs and arrangements to ensure the venue looks perfect. To help you shop around for the ideal floral arrangements, here are some tips to follow:

Consider the Venue

The floral designs that you will choose should match the venue of your celebration. For simple celebrations, such as an engagement party in a smaller room, you can pick arrangements that use small or dainty flowers. This type of decoration can make the event more intimate. However, for large events like an opening of a new hotel, it is ideal to choose large varieties as these work best for an elegant interior hotel design.

Consider the Atmosphere

Use the atmosphere of the venue as your basis as well. If the event is going to be vibrant, pick various flowers with different colours and add other elements - e.g. ribbons or balloons - to the decorations. These can easily mix in with the lively atmosphere. On the other hand, if you are planning a formal celebration, you can stick with two or three types and shades of flowers to create a serene ambience.

Consider the Colours and Styles

You should pick flowers that compliment the theme. Whatever designs and arrangements are to be used, make sure that the colours are coherent to create a consistent look. Moreover, you should take into consideration the main colours and styles present in the venue. If your event is held in a hotel, opt for simple decorations if the room interior is more charming than sophisticated, while go for chic ones if the hotel design is elegant.

Consider the Goal of the Event

See to it that the flowers suit the goal of the event. If it is a wedding, a gala event or any social gathering, you should go for a fancy floral design. You can ask the florist to incorporate large vases, candlesticks and other novelty accessories to the arrangements. For corporate gatherings, it is best to use a floral setting that is simple to ensure the table centrepieces will not get in the way of the conversations between guests.
